I had to do this one simply because everyone should hear the greatest word ever invented: Batsquatch. Yes, as if a gigantic woodland hominid wasn't enough, there are also tales of a version that flies.

In 1994 the Tacoma News Tribune published an account of a young motorist who described a disturbing encounter with a gigantic, blue, bat-winged figure with red glowing eyes on a remote country road near Mount Rainier.

Since then, several other stories of equal... um, credibility have added to the legend that is Batsquatch. Batsquatch sightings often include grisly animal mutilation, so this could be a vacationing Chupacabra, or his not-so-original northern cousin. But let's not judge.
